Choosing the Right Patio Design for Beginners
Selecting the perfect patio design is crucial to achieving the outdoor space of your dreams. Here are a few considerations to keep in mind:
- Assess Your Space: Begin by evaluating the size and shape of your outdoor area. This will help you determine what type of patio will fit best.
- Purpose and Functionality: Consider what activities you plan to host on your patio. Are you looking to entertain guests, create a cozy retreat, or perhaps a mix of both?
- Material Selection: Choose materials that complement your home and suit your climate. Common choices include concrete, brick, and natural stone.
- Budget Planning: Designing a patio involves various costs. It’s essential to have a clear budget to avoid overspending.

Essential Steps to a Successful Patio Installation
Embarking on a patio installation project can seem daunting, but breaking it down into manageable steps makes it achievable for any beginner.
-
Planning and Design:
- Sketch your ideas and finalize the layout.
- Make sure to check any local building codes or regulations in Upton that may affect your project.
-
Gathering Materials:
- Purchase or order the necessary materials based on your design.
- It’s wise to buy slightly more material than you estimate to account for any mistakes or adjustments.
-
Site Preparation:
- Clear the area of any debris and level the ground.
- Ensure proper drainage by sloping the patio away from your home.
-
Laying the Foundation:
- Depending on the chosen material, this may involve laying a sand or gravel base.
- Compact the base to prevent future settling.
-
Setting the Patio Surface:
- Arrange your chosen materials, be it pavers, slabs, or tiles, according to your design.
- Use a level to ensure even placement and adjust as needed.
-
Finishing Touches:
- Fill the joints with sand or grout for stability.
- Seal the surface if required to protect against weathering.
